Transaction 5987cfe51cfcefa920b434e8047c99403dfa03ec73ce4a6b1d690de5ae91e0d9

4 Input
2 Outputs
  • 5987cfe51cfcefa920b434e8047c99403dfa03ec73ce4a6b1d690de5ae91e0d9:0
  • value  187198
    address  1LhaXwQQZpTjjApA7pQkxSpRrAhbUpForp
  • 5987cfe51cfcefa920b434e8047c99403dfa03ec73ce4a6b1d690de5ae91e0d9:1
  • value  17766000
    address  3KSz9cfNm7mgDPWbn2ZEdhDCnSak4mKGqY